A Role That Took Nearly a Decade to Bring to Life

Before filming even began, Johnny Depp had already spent years preparing for the role of John Wilmot, a notorious 17th-century English poet known for his scandalous lifestyle and provocative writing.

The historical figure was famous for his rebellious personality, open criticism of authority, and deeply controversial views about society and morality. For an actor known for eccentric roles, the character was both a perfect match and an enormous challenge.

Depp first became interested in the story in the 1990s after seeing a stage production written by playwright Stephen Jeffreys. The play offered an unfiltered look at Wilmot’s life, exploring themes of artistic freedom, addiction, and self-destruction.

Instead of portraying the poet as a romantic hero, the story depicted him as a deeply flawed genius whose brilliance was inseparable from his personal chaos.

For Depp, the role represented something rare in Hollywood: a character driven entirely by psychological depth rather than spectacle.

The Story Behind the Film’s Dark Narrative

Set in the royal court of Charles II, The Libertine follows John Wilmot’s rise and fall as one of the most infamous figures in Restoration England.

Wilmot begins as a favored member of the king’s inner circle, admired for his wit and intelligence. However, his provocative writings, excessive drinking, and rebellious nature quickly push him toward scandal and exile.

A Cast of Acclaimed Actors

Despite its limited release, The Libertine featured a remarkable ensemble cast.

The film starred Samantha Morton, who played the ambitious actress Elizabeth Barry, a character whose career is shaped by Wilmot’s controversial mentorship. Morton’s performance brought emotional complexity to the film, portraying the difficult path of a woman trying to succeed in a male-dominated artistic world.

Another standout role came from John Malkovich, who portrayed King Charles II. Known for his commanding screen presence, Malkovich delivered a nuanced portrayal of a ruler navigating the delicate balance between power and political stability.

A Film Released at the Wrong Moment

When The Libertine premiered in 2005, Johnny Depp was at the peak of global popularity thanks to Pirates of the Caribbean.

Studios were eager to capitalize on Depp’s reputation as a charismatic adventure star. His portrayal of Captain Jack Sparrow had transformed him into one of Hollywood’s most bankable actors.

The stark contrast between the swashbuckling pirate and the morally complex John Wilmot created a marketing dilemma.

While Pirates of the Caribbean attracted families and blockbuster audiences, The Libertine targeted a far more niche demographic interested in historical drama and literary storytelling.

The film’s explicit themes, including sexuality, addiction, and moral corruption, made it difficult to promote alongside Depp’s mainstream image.

Many industry observers believe this mismatch played a major role in the film’s quiet release.

Controversy Surrounding Its Distribution

Another major factor often discussed by film analysts involves the role of Harvey Weinstein, the powerful producer and studio executive whose company handled the film’s distribution in the United States.

According to several reports circulating in the entertainment industry, the film did not receive the level of marketing typically given to a project starring a major Hollywood actor.

Promotional campaigns were limited, theatrical distribution was narrow, and the movie quickly disappeared from cinemas.

Over time, speculation grew that studio executives may have been uncertain about how to position the film in the market.

Without strong marketing support, even a film starring Johnny Depp struggled to gain visibility among audiences.
